Dealing with offenders in a dignified manner adheres to which conduct guideline?

Explanation:
Dealing with offenders in a dignified manner is closely aligned with the guideline of maintaining professionalism. This conduct guideline emphasizes the importance of treating all individuals, including offenders, with respect and fairness, regardless of the situation. Professionalism in law enforcement is crucial for fostering trust and legitimacy within the community. When security forces engage offenders respectfully, they not only fulfill operational responsibilities but also uphold the values of integrity and empathy that are essential in their role. Treating offenders with dignity can lead to more effective communication, cooperation, and adherence to lawful procedures, which ultimately contributes to a positive relationship between law enforcement and the community they serve. This approach does not undermine the mission or the adherence to legal standards; rather, it supports a method of crime prevention and resolution that can be beneficial to public safety. So, in this context, maintaining professionalism is foundational to effectively carrying out responsibilities while upholding the rights of individuals involved.
